    Yeah the "SR5 XP" model is only available in the SouthEast (I live in NC). It includes a bunch of add on's such as the towing package, the rims, side bars, chrome tip exhaust, color keyed fenders and some other things. Convenient for some of us that don't have much time to search and build.
